Over time, a number of algorithms have been proposed to triangulate a polygon. It is trivial to triangulate any convex polygon in linear time into a fan triangulation, by adding diagonals from one vertex to all other non-nearest neighbor vertices. WebA triangle is a 3-sided polygon sometimes (but not very commonly) called the trigon. Every triangle has three sides and three angles, some of which may be the same. WebWeb in geometry, a polygon (/ ˈ p ɒ l ɪ ɡ ɒ n /) is a plane figure made up of line segments connected to form a closed polygonal chain. Web10 sep. 2024 · A convex polygon is a polygon with all its interior angles less than 180°, which means all the vertices point away from the interior of the polygon. We discuss this separately as the most common types of polygons encountered in computer vision are convex polygons. Theses includes all triangles, squares, parallelograms, trapezoids, etc.
